David Hamelech received from his bed and was thoroughly healthy when he gave in excess of and worked on that architecture. Rav Chaim Kanievsky provides that David Hamelech said this Mizmor when he handed in excess of the scroll Using the architectural strategies. It had been his Thank You for getting out of his sickness. With that context, we will be able to understand why It really is called Mizmor Shir Hanukat HaBayit L’David . He wrote it for them to sing at the particular Hanukat Habayit, which he wasn't going to make it to. But he spoke about his sickness since what bought him out was The reality that he desired To do that. Also, a pasuk in this chapter claims, זמרו לה׳ חסידיו /Sing to Hashem, the pious ones, והודו לזכר קדשו and thank Him. Initial sing, then thank Him. Most time It can be thank initially and after that sing, like it suggests, ט֗וֹב לְהֹד֥וֹת לה׳ וּלְזַמֵּ֖ר לְשִׁמְךָ֣ עֶלְיֽוֹן׃ “It really is very good to thank You, and then you sing a song.” Mainly because it says, Shiru Lo, Zamru Lo/sing tunes. Generally, 1st you thank Hashem for what occurred and Then you really sing the song. But below he says the pious kinds, they sing the track even ahead of it occurs. David Hamelech was already singing the music of his salvation, right before it occurred. And he gives numerous motives to have from his sickness. “ Am daily bitachon i able to thanks After i'm just dust? (meaning, Am i able to thank You Once i'm dead?) ” Then he claims, “ Am i able to say over Your truth of the matter?” These motives refers back to the two things that anyone is in this article on the globe for: to thank Hashem and to state His Oneness. David was applying these being a purpose to tug him away from his sickness. This is significant. When a person is in problems, somebody can Truthfully and sincerely say, “ Hashem, get me from issues simply because I nonetheless have a mission to accomplish. I nevertheless have something to accomplish. Get me out of the. I really need to praise You. I want to meet my mission.” This was David Hamelech’s mystery of Mizmor Shir Hanukat Habayit L’David.
